Corten steel, also recognized as weathering steel, is a type of high-strength alloy steel distinguished by its remarkable ability to form a protective rust layer naturally. This self-healing patina not only enhances the steel's visual appeal but also effectively inhibits further more info corrosion. Produced through a precise alloying process, Corten steel incorporates elements such as chromium, nickel, and copper, which contribute to its exceptional resistance against atmospheric degradation. Its durability and aesthetic versatility have made it a popular choice for diverse applications in both architectural and industrial settings.

Corten steel, a celebrated alloy defined by its distinctive reddish-brown exterior, has gained widespread recognition for its remarkable durability and resistance to corrosion. This metal is composed primarily of iron with a small percentage of copper, chromium, nickel, and silicon. The inclusion of these elements creates a protective oxide layer on the steel's surface, effectively shielding it from the harsh effects of environmental exposure.
This unique feature allows Corten steel to endure prolonged exposure to moisture, temperature fluctuations, and even pollutants without noticeable deterioration. Furthermore, its pleasingly appealing patina adds a unconventional architectural element to structures, making it a popular choice for both contemporary and traditional designs.

Weathering Steel: Understanding Corrosion Resistance in Architecture
Weathering steel has become a popular option in architecture due to its unique ability to develop a protective patina over time. This natural process of rusting results in a durable and visually dramatic surface that can withstand the elements for decades. Architects appreciate weathering steel for its aesthetic properties, strength, and low upkeep.
- Additionally, weathering steel's natural patina often harmonizes seamlessly with the surrounding environment, creating a sense of permanence and belonging.
- The use of weathering steel in architecture can also enhance the sustainability of buildings by reducing the need for painting or other coatings.
Understanding the nuances of weathering steel's corrosion resistance is crucial for architects to successfully utilize this material in their designs.
